Is SQL developer a remote job?

SQL developer roles are often available as remote positions, especially with the increase in telecommuting options. Many companies hire SQL developers to work remotely, requiring strong SQL skills, experience with database management tools, and good communication abilities. Remote SQL developer jobs typically involve collaborating with teams via online platforms and may require specific certifications or experience with cloud-based databases.

Are remote SQL programmers in demand?

Remote SQL programmers are in high demand due to the widespread need for data management and analysis across industries. Strong skills in SQL, database design, and experience with tools like MySQL or PostgreSQL increase employability, especially in organizations adopting remote work models.

Remote Sql Coding primarily involves writing and optimizing SQL queries remotely, often for data analysis or reporting. Remote Database Developers handle comprehensive database design, development, and maintenance tasks. While both roles require SQL expertise and remote work skills, Database Developers typically have broader responsibilities in database architecture and integration, making them more comprehensive roles compared to focused SQL coding tasks.

How much do remote SQL developers make?

Remote SQL developers typically earn between $60,000 and $120,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and skill level. Senior developers with advanced knowledge of database management and query optimization can earn higher salaries, especially if they work for large organizations or have specialized certifications.

As the Senior Manager of Software Engineering for the PharmScript application team, you will lead the modern transformation of our core application platforms. Our team is focused on migrating legacy, older-generation technologies into a high-performance, modern architecture utilizing Go (Golang), SQL Server, and Azure. In this role, you will be both a strategic leader and a hands-on technical architect, driving end-to-end development processes while designing and deploying innovative, intelligent solutions. If you are passionate about combining robust hands-on development with state-of-the-art AI-assisted tools to rebuild enterprise-scale platforms, this role offers an exciting opportunity to make a massive impact on the future of healthcare pharmacy technology.


You'll enjoy the flexibility to work remotely * from anywhere within the U.S. as you take on some tough challenges. For all hires in the Minneapolis or Washington, D.C. area, you will be required to work in the office a minimum of four days per week.


Primary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age a high-performing software engineering team, establishing functional strategies, development plans, and engineering priorities
  • Direct hands-on software development and modernization efforts, migrating legacy application code to a modern Go (Golang), SQL Server, and Azure infrastructure
  • Design, develop, and deploy intelligent, AI-powered solutions to solve complex business challenges, with an emphasis on the responsible use of AI
  • Use enterprise-approved AI tools and modern automation techniques to streamline workflows, optimize software development lifecycles, and drive continuous operational improvement
  • Evaluate emerging technology trends, cloud capabilities, and AI advancements to inform solution design and lead strategic innovations
  • Identify and resolve complex technical, operational, and organizational problems across team boundaries
  • Make product, service, or process decisions that have a broad impact on internal business functions and external customer accounts
